Biography

Dr. Ronald Barg is a Clinical Assistant Professor at Penn Medicine, specializing in Internal Medicine. He is dedicated to providing comprehensive primary care to adults, focusing on preventive health measures and the management of chronic conditions. With a medical degree from the University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ine and residency training at Hahnemann University Hospital, he has garnered a reputation for being knowledgeable and approachable. Dr. Barg has extensive experience treating a wide range of health issues, including diabetes, hypertension, respiratory conditions, and mental health concerns. Over the years, he has emphasized the importance of effective communication with patients, ensuring that they feel heard and understood in their healthcare journey. His commitment to patient education also plays a vital role in his practice, aiming to empower individuals to take charge of their health. Notably, Dr. Barg integrates the latest evidence-based practices into his care methodologies, offering a personalized approach tailored to each patient's unique needs. His board certifications and involvement in the medical community reflect his dedication to continuous learning and improvement in clinical practice.
